Who is the best Indian ODI Captain? Dhoni, Ganguly or Kohli

Published Date:

BCCI has decided to appoint Rohit Sharma as the successor of Virat Kohli in the white ball Cricket as he is the newest full time ODI skipper of the Indian Cricket Team.

Rohit Sharma took over the T20 captaincy following the T20 World Cup after Virat Kohli stepped out as the T20 skipper.

BCCI thought it is better to have a single white ball skipper rather than two and create ruckus in the team.

The decision was the end of Virat Kohli’s current stint as the white ball skipper, while he continue to lead Team India in the longest format of the game.

This does raise the question about who has been the best ODI skipper for Team India over the long march of time.

Here are the best Indian ODI Captains:

1) MS Dhoni

The sole reason, MS Dhoni is above everyone in the list is because he has achieved everything and is the only person in the cricketing history to do so.

He has won all three major Trophies, The ICC Cricket World Cup, ICC Champions Trophy and The ICC T20 Cricket World Cup.

He even lead Team India to become number 1 test team and is the only person to lead Men in Blue in 200 ODI matches with a winning average of 59.52%.

2) Virat Kohli

Virat Kohli is undoubtedly the most successful ODI Captain for Team India in terms of Wins and losses.

He is the only ODI skipper to have Captained Team India in over 90 matches and have an winning average of 70.43%.

The only blot on the bright stint and career of Virat Kohli is his faliure to not win any major trophy during his time as the captain.

3) Sourav Ganguly

Sourav Ganguly is one of the most iconic Indian Captain. It is said that he was the one that taught Team India to fight and win on the foreign soil.

Team India won the 2002 Champion’s Trophy under Sourav Ganguly along with the Natwest Trophy.

Men in Blue’s victory over England at Lords following by the T-Shirt swing by Dada is still one of the most Iconic moment in Indian history. He has a splendid win percentage of 53.90 in ODIs.

4) Mohammad Azharuddin

Mohammad Azharuddin held the record for most wins and matches as an ODI Skipper for Team India until surpassed by none other than MS Dhoni.

Team has won 90 ODI matches under the Mohammad Azharuddin. He was the ODI Skipper for a record 174 matches.

Mohammad Azharuddin has an amazing win percentage of 54.16 in ODIs.

All Indian Skippers had their amazing and iconic moments during their stint.

Rohit Sharma is the newest successor for the White ball cricket and hopefully he will have a great successful run.
